Hello!
I have dual processor motherboard with IO apic. All was fine till I added one more card in. M/B has 5 PCI/2 ISA slots on it. Now I have (from 1st to 5th PCI slot) 3 realtek 8029 cards, Adaptec SCSI card (this one is detected as 2 devices scsi devices), and SMC1211TX EZCard 10/100 (RealTek RTL8139). Motherboard initially assigns irqs below 16 to all devices, But then linux rearanges these irq alocations. Assigned irqs: ccssu:~# cat /proc/interrupts CPU0 CPU1 0: 79973 79426 IO-APIC-edge timer 1: 2259 2512 IO-APIC-edge keyboard 2: 0 0 XT-PIC cascade 4: 59637 60742 IO-APIC-edge serial 8: 1 0 IO-APIC-edge rtc 10: 33018 30528 IO-APIC-edge serial 12: 1270 1331 IO-APIC-edge PS/2 Mouse 13: 1 0 XT-PIC fpu 14: 7 1 IO-APIC-edge ide0 15: 32 24 IO-APIC-edge ide1 16: 4894 4716 IO-APIC-level aic7xxx, eth0, eth3 17: 7272 7401 IO-APIC-level eth1 18: 2030 1997 IO-APIC-level eth2 19: 7628 7766 IO-APIC-level aic7xxx
Now is the question: Why three devices on one irq line, when there is still some free irqs? How can I change things? Yes, I have read Documentation/IO-APIC.txt, but seems that it deals with blacklisted/unknown IO-Apics and assumes that whitelisted should be ok, or can I use described method in my case too? Then what to do with SCSI card? It eats 2 irqs and is shown as 2 PCI devices: ccssu:~# lspci | grep AIC 00:0b.0 SCSI storage controller: Adaptec AIC-7895 (rev 04) 00:0b.1 SCSI storage controller: Adaptec AIC-7895 (rev 04)
BTW, I tried to change location of cards and IRQ layout was a little different but stiil not desired. (e.g. I can get irq 16 shared between aic7xxx and eth0 and irq 18 shared between aic7xxx with eth1)
